Just the opposite. My wife discovered "Vaseline glass" last year.

Vaseline glass is regular glass that has been "tinted" with Uraniumoxide to make the glass yellow.

The "cool" part is that because of the Uraniumoxide, the glass glows under black (UV) light.

What I ended up with is a rack style stereo component cabinet full of various pieces of yellow glass iluminated with black lights.
